const char *unhash(const unsigned char *hash) {
static char buffer[33];
static char table[] = "0123456789abcdef";
unsigned i, j;
for (i = 0, j = 0; i < 16; ++i) {
unsigned char c = hash[i];
buffer[j++] = table[c >> 4];
buffer[j++] = table[c & 0x0f];
}
buffer[j] = 0;
return buffer;
}
const char *md5(int fd, uint32_t length) {
hash_state md;
static uint8_t buffer[4096];
uint8_t hash[16];
md5_init(&md);
while (length) {
long l;
uint32_t count = sizeof(buffer);
if (count > length) count = length;
l = read(fd, buffer, count);
if (l < 0) {
if (errno == EINTR) continue;
return NULL;
}
if (l == 0) break;
md5_process(&md, buffer, l);
length -= l;
}
if (length) return NULL;
md5_done(&md, hash);
return unhash(hash);
}
